Sweet Corn Casserole:joanpics254-9473744

½ cup butter, melted
2 eggs, beaten
1 box corn bread mix
1 can kernel sweet corn
1 can creamed corn
1 cup sour cream

Preheat oven to 350.
In a bowl, combine all ingredients.
Bake in oven for 45 min.
